Max separated the workers by gender and then asked only the men to work the evening shift from 5 P.M. to closing. This is an exa
Lady bird [3.3K]

Answer:

D. Disparate treatment

Explanation:

Disparate treatment is a form of unlawful discrimination in the labour force. It's when a manager or leader gives unequal treatments to workers because of a certain characteristics. It is an intentional employment discrimination.

In this situation, the men suffers the evening shift just because they are men (certain characteristics).

Apart from gender another characteristics that is subjected to unequal treatments is race, where one race suffer more treatment than the other race.

An industry that has many companies offering the same basic product, but with some slight difference is
mario62 [17]

An industry that has many companies offering the same basic product, but with some slight difference is B. monopolistic competition.

Monopolistic competition is found in industries where slight differences of a product is possible but they basically offer the same thing. A few examples of monopolistic competition are those in the restaurant or hospitality career field. These businesses offer food or hotel rooms which are what their competitions offer as well, but what they include within their packages or their food offerings may differ.
